Defining an IBS Flare vs Baseline IBS Symptoms

It's crucial to distinguish between baseline IBS symptoms and a flare. Baseline symptoms are the low-level, often chronic issues a person may experience daily or frequently, such as mild bloating or occasional changes in bowel habits. An IBS flare, however, is a pronounced exacerbation of symptoms. It’s a period of heightened intensity and discomfort, where symptoms like cramping, urgent diarrhea, severe bloating, or constipation become disruptive to daily activities. Recognizing this difference helps in applying the correct management strategy—ongoing maintenance for baseline symptoms and acute interventions for a flare.

Common Triggers and Their Typical Flare Patterns

IBS flares are often precipitated by identifiable triggers. The most common include:

  • Dietary Triggers: High-FODMAP foods, spicy foods, large meals, caffeine, or alcohol can trigger symptoms within hours.
  • Stress: Psychological stress is a powerful trigger due to the gut-brain connection, often causing flares during or after stressful periods.
  • Hormonal Fluctuations: Many people with IBS, particularly women, report worsened symptoms around their menstrual cycle.
  • Infections: A bout of gastroenteritis ("stomach flu") can trigger post-infectious IBS or a significant flare in existing IBS.

The Gut-Brain Connection: Stress, Mood, and Symptom Perception

The bidirectional communication network between the gut and the brain, known as the gut-brain axis, is central to IBS. Stress and anxiety can heighten gut sensitivity (visceral hypersensitivity) and alter motility, making you more susceptible to flares. Conversely, the discomfort of a flare can increase anxiety and low mood, creating a vicious cycle. Managing stress through techniques like mindfulness or cognitive-behavioral therapy is a critical component of breaking this cycle.

Typical Symptoms During an IBS Flare

An IBS flare can manifest in several ways, depending on the individual's subtype (IBS-D, IBS-C, IBS-M). Common symptoms include:

  • Abdominal cramping or pain, often relieved by a bowel movement.
  • Pronounced bloating and visible distension of the abdomen.
  • Diarrhea (IBS-D) or constipation (IBS-C), or an alternation between the two (IBS-M).
  • A sudden, urgent need to have a bowel movement.
  • Excessive gas.

Subtle Signals and Differentiating IBS Flares From Other GI Issues

It's important to distinguish an IBS flare from symptoms of other conditions. IBS is a functional disorder, meaning symptoms occur without visible structural damage. Subtle signals that point toward IBS include symptom relief after defecation and a correlation with stress or specific foods. However, only a healthcare provider can make a formal diagnosis after ruling out other conditions like inflammatory bowel disease (IBD), celiac disease, or food intolerances.

When to Seek Urgent Medical Evaluation (Red Flags)

Consult a doctor immediately if you experience any "red flag" symptoms, as these are not typical of IBS and could indicate a more serious condition:

  • Unexplained weight loss
  • Fever
  • Rectal bleeding or bloody stools
  • Severe, persistent pain that doesn't resolve
  • Symptoms that begin after age 50
  • A family history of IBD or colorectal cancer

Subtypes of IBS and Personal Symptom Profiles

IBS is not a monolith. It's categorized into subtypes based on the predominant bowel habit: IBS with Diarrhea (IBS-D), IBS with Constipation (IBS-C), IBS with Mixed bowel habits (IBS-M), and Unsubtyped IBS. Your subtype will heavily influence which dietary and medication strategies are most effective, highlighting the need for a personalized approach from the start.

Multifactorial Roots: Motility, Secretion, Immunity, and the Microbiome

The root causes of IBS are multifactorial, meaning several biological mechanisms can be at play simultaneously. These include:

  • Altered Gut Motility: The muscles of the digestive tract may contract too quickly (causing diarrhea) or too slowly (causing constipation).
  • Visceral Hypersensitivity: The nerves in the gut are overly sensitive, interpreting normal digestive sensations as pain.
  • Immune System Activation: Low-grade inflammation or immune activity in the gut lining may be present.
  • Microbiome Imbalance (Dysbiosis): An disrupted gut microbial ecosystem is a key player, which we will explore in detail.

Mechanisms: Fermentation By Gut Microbes, Gas Production, and Bloating

When the microbial balance is off, the fermentation of dietary fibers and other carbohydrates can become inefficient. Certain microbes may produce excessive amounts of hydrogen, methane, or hydrogen sulfide gas. This gas production is a primary driver of the bloating, distension, and cramping pain experienced during a flare, especially after meals.

Impacts on Intestinal Barrier Function and Low-Grade Inflammation

A healthy microbiome helps maintain the integrity of the intestinal lining, often called the "gut barrier." Dysbiosis can compromise this barrier, leading to a "leaky gut" where tiny particles pass into the bloodstream that shouldn't. This can activate the immune system, leading to a state of continuous, low-grade inflammation that heightens gut sensitivity and reactivity.

Interactions With Gut Motility and Stool Consistency

Gut microbes produce short-chain fatty acids and other metabolites that influence the nervous system of the gut. For example, methane gas produced by certain archaea has been shown to slow down gut transit, contributing to constipation (IBS-C). Conversely, other microbial patterns may accelerate transit, leading to diarrhea (IBS-D).

Limitations and Uncertainities of Microbiome Tests

It's crucial to understand the limitations. Microbiome testing is a developing science. It provides insights and correlations, not definitive diagnoses. It cannot detect SIBO (Small Intestinal Bacterial Overgrowth) directly, as it analyzes colonic bacteria. Results can also vary daily based on diet, stress, and medications. Therefore, these tests should be used as an educational tool to inform a broader management plan, not as a standalone solution.

Dietary Approaches Aligned With IBS Management

For long-term management, dietary adjustment is key. The low-FODMAP diet is a well-researched option, but it should be done in three phases under supervision: 1) Elimination (strict low-FODMAP for 2-6 weeks), 2) Reintroduction (systematically testing high-FODMAP foods), and 3) Personalization (creating a long-term diet based on your tolerances). This avoids unnecessary long-term restriction.

Q4: Is the low-FODMAP diet meant to be followed forever?
No. The low-FODMAP diet is a diagnostic elimination diet designed to identify triggers, not a permanent eating plan. The final phase involves reintroducing foods to create a personalized, varied, and less restrictive long-term diet.

Q5: What’s the difference between IBS and IBD?
IBS (Irritable Bowel Syndrome) is a functional disorder without visible inflammation or tissue damage. IBD (Inflammatory Bowel Disease, like Crohn's or Ulcerative Colitis) involves chronic inflammation and damage to the digestive tract and is a more serious medical condition.

Q6: Can a microbiome test diagnose IBS?
No. Microbiome tests cannot diagnose IBS. Diagnosis is made by a doctor based on symptom criteria and ruling out other conditions. A microbiome test provides insights into potential underlying imbalances that may be contributing to your symptoms.

Q9: Are there risks to trying a low-FODMAP diet without guidance?
Yes. If done incorrectly or for too long, it can lead to nutritional deficiencies and negatively impact your gut microbiome by starving beneficial bacteria. It's best undertaken with the support of a registered dietitian.
